Zab Judah gave a spirited effort against Danny Garcia on a Golden Boy Promotions card in April.
The fight might have paved the way for a new relationship.
BoxingScene.com has been advised that Judah, along with his promotional firm Super Judah Promotions, is working toward a deal with Golden Boy to promote his next few fights, per a source familiar with the talks.
Golden Boy has a rich stable of fighters at 140 pounds, where Judah currently campaigns, and also at 147 where Judah formerly competed. Judah was the undisputed welterweight champion in 2005.
The 35-year-old resident of Las Vegas gave a good account of himself against Garcia and certainly has some good fights left in the tank. He also still draws in his native Brooklyn, N.Y., where Golden Boy has focused on promoting their east coast bouts, buoyed by their exclusive deal with Barclays Center.
The last time Judah exclusively was fighting under the banner of a major promoter, it was with Main Events from 2010 to 2012. His fights against Amir Khan and Lucas Matthysse were Main Events-Golden Boy co-promotions.
